Freigeben über


D3DKMT_MULTIPLANE_OVERLAY_ATTRIBUTES2 Struktur (d3dkmthk.h)

Enthält Mehrschichtattribute.

Syntax

typedef struct _D3DKMT_MULTIPLANE_OVERLAY_ATTRIBUTES2 {
  UINT                                         Flags;
  RECT                                         SrcRect;
  RECT                                         DstRect;
  RECT                                         ClipRect;
  D3DDDI_ROTATION                              Rotation;
  D3DKMT_MULTIPLANE_OVERLAY_BLEND              Blend;
  UINT                                         DirtyRectCount;
  void                                         D3DKMT_PTR(
    RECT        *unnamedParam1,
    pDirtyRects unnamedParam2
  );
  D3DKMT_MULTIPLANE_OVERLAY_VIDEO_FRAME_FORMAT VideoFrameFormat;
  D3DDDI_COLOR_SPACE_TYPE                      ColorSpace;
  D3DKMT_MULTIPLANE_OVERLAY_STEREO_FORMAT      StereoFormat;
  BOOL                                         StereoLeftViewFrame0;
  BOOL                                         StereoBaseViewFrame0;
  DXGKMT_MULTIPLANE_OVERLAY_STEREO_FLIP_MODE   StereoFlipMode;
  DXGKMT_MULTIPLANE_OVERLAY_STRETCH_QUALITY    StretchQuality;
  UINT                                         Reserved1;
} D3DKMT_MULTIPLANE_OVERLAY_ATTRIBUTES2;

Member

Flags

Flagoptionen.

SrcRect

Gibt das Quellrechteck an.

DstRect

Gibt das Zielrechteck an.

ClipRect

Gibt alle zusätzlichen Ausschnitte an.

Rotation

Gibt die Drehung der Überlagerungsebene im Uhrzeigersinn an.

Blend

Gibt den Mischmodus an, der für diese Überlagerungsebene und die darunter liegende Ebene gilt.

DirtyRectCount

Die Anzahl der modifiziert Rechtecke.

void D3DKMT_PTR( RECT *unnamedParam1, pDirtyRects unnamedParam2)

VideoFrameFormat

ColorSpace

Der Farbraum der Daten.

StereoFormat

Stereoformat.

StereoLeftViewFrame0

Stereoansicht links Frame 0.

StereoBaseViewFrame0

Stereo-Basisansicht Frame 0.

StereoFlipMode

Stereo-Flipmodus.

StretchQuality

Stretchqualität.

Reserved1

Für die interne Verwendung reserviert.

Anforderungen

Anforderung Wert
Header d3dkmthk.h